Sitting down with the 's Nada Tawfik near his home in Santa Barbara, California, the Duke spoke about a court ruling today on his security in the UK after losing his appeal.
Harry said: "Of course some members of my family will never forgive me for writing a book, of course they will never forgive me for lots of things, but I would love reconcilation with my family. There's no point in continuing to fight anymore."
He also said he is not currently speaking to King Charles, claiming his father "won't" speak to him as a result of the latest "security" case.
